Kunwarpur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Kunwarpur Village has a population of 1.28 k (1,276) with 667 (667) males and 609 (609) females.The sex ratio in Kunwarpur is 914, indicating a below-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Kunwarpur Village is 229 (229) which is 17.95% of Kunwarpur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Kunwarpur Village is 1181 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Kunwarpur village is listed as part of the Chanderi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Ashoknagar District in the state of MADHYA PRADESH in INDIA.
The majority of the Village population resides in Rural areas.

Kunwarpur Literacy Rate
Kunwarpur Village has a literacy rate of 66.76%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Kunwarpur Village is 81.67 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Kunwarpur Village is 49.48 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Kunwarpur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Kunwarpur Village is 296 (296) with 151 (151) males and 145 (145) females, which is 23.2% of Kunwarpur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 961 females for every 1000 males.
Kunwarpur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es(ST) Population in Kunwarpur Village is 104 (104) with 51 (51) males and 53 (53) females, which is 8.15% of Kunwarpur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Tribes is 1040 females for every 1000 males.

Kunwarpur Area & Households
The Total Number of households in Kunwarpur Village are 356 (356).
Kunwarpur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Kunwarpur Village, there are about 581 (581) workers, making up nearly 45.53% of the Kunwarpur Village total population. Out of these, around 357 (357) are male workers, and about 224 (224) are female workers.
